HICKORY, N.C. – The Lenoir Rhyne University Bears announced on Apr. 22 that former University of Dayton Assistant Women's Soccer Coach
Dean Ward would be named the school's next head coach for the 2022 season.
"This is a tremendous opportunity for Dean and his wife Jeri, to take the next step in his career while leading what has been a highly successful program," commented Flyers head women's soccer coach
Eric Golz. "I am incredibly excited for this next step in the continued growth of his career, while also being incredibly grateful for his many and significant contributions in his time here at the University of Dayton. Dean has had a tremendous impact on the growth of our program, and his legacy will live beyond his time here in his impact on the women he coached as well as the incredibly talented women he has played a vital role in recruiting to Dayton. He is a first class person, and a talented professional; he has been extremely loyal and committed to our program."
Ward joined the Flyers staff in 2017, following a five-year stint with the University of Tennessee. During his time with Dayton, Ward helped the Flyers earn Atlantic 10 Tournament berths in every season he was with the program and helped develop seven A-10 All-Rookie team players. Additionally, Ward coached seven players who were named to the A-10 All-Conference Team and seven to the A-10 All-Academic Team. Alexis Kiehl was named A-10 Offensive Player of the Year in 2017-18 with
Itala Gemelli picking up the A-10 Rookie of the Year in 2020-21 and the league's Player of the Year in 2021.
